Burna Boy and the Arrest of Speed Darlington: A Deep Dive into the Controversy Rocking the Nigerian Music Scene

The Nigerian music industry is once again under the spotlight due to a controversial incident involving Afrobeats superstar Burna Boy and rising content creator Speed Darlington. The drama began when Speed Darlington, known for his humorous yet provocative social media presence, was reported missing, leading to an emotional plea from his mother, Miss Queen, for assistance in securing his release. The implications of this situation have not only raised questions about the dynamics within the Nigerian entertainment industry but have also sparked debates about the responsibilities of celebrities and their influence on fans and creators alike.

The Plea from Miss Queen

In a heartfelt video that quickly gained traction on social media, Miss Queen, the mother of Speed Darlington, directly addressed Burna Boy, pleading for mercy and understanding. She claimed that her son had been picked up by individuals connected to Burna Boy and expressed her anguish over his disappearance. “Speed is my only son. I am begging my fellow Nigerians – everyone should help me beg Burna Boy,” she implored, emphasizing the desperation of her situation. Her emotional appeal underscored a mother’s love and the lengths to which she would go to seek her child’s safety.

Miss Queen’s assertions suggest a connection between Speed’s disappearance and a recent video he posted, where he made pointed comments about Burna Boy. She alleged that her son’s gateman had informed the family that Speed’s arrest was related to this video, further fueling speculation about the circumstances surrounding his detainment. The contents of the video included provocative remarks questioning Burna Boy’s Grammy win for his album “Twice as Tall,” and even insinuated that the artist’s connections with American rapper Diddy might be questionable.

The Backstory of the Conflict

Speed Darlington, whose real name is Darlington Okoye, has built a reputation on social media for his unique blend of comedy and controversial opinions. His content often touches on sensitive topics, and his recent comments regarding Burna Boy’s success were no exception. In the viral video, he playfully questioned how much work was truly involved in earning the Grammy award, given Diddy’s involvement as an executive producer on the album. This line of inquiry may have struck a nerve with Burna Boy, leading to the unfortunate sequence of events that followed.

The Reaction from the Public and Media

As news of Speed Darlington’s arrest spread, reactions poured in from fans and fellow creators. Many expressed outrage over the perceived misuse of power by Burna Boy and his team. Activist and lawyer Deji Adeyanju took to social media to confirm that Speed Darlington had been detained by the Nigerian Police Force, suggesting that a petition against him had indeed been initiated by Burna Boy. “We just spent the last 30 minutes with Speed Darlington,” he stated, shedding light on the gravity of the situation and indicating that Speed had been moved around before being brought to Abuja for detention.

The public’s reaction highlighted a significant divide in opinions. Some fans rallied behind Speed Darlington, seeing him as a victim of celebrity power, while others criticized him for provoking a well-established artist like Burna Boy. This incident has opened up discussions about the responsibilities that come with fame and influence, particularly regarding how artists handle criticism and dissent.

Speed Darlington’s Release and Aftermath

Reports later confirmed that Speed Darlington had been released on bail, bringing some relief to his supporters and family. Burna Boy’s Position in the Industry

Burna Boy, born Damini Ebunoluwa Ogulu, is one of the most celebrated artists in Afrobeats, known for his distinctive sound and global appeal. However, his career has not been without its controversies. In June 2022, reports surfaced of his aides being involved in a shooting incident at a Lagos club after a woman refused to engage with him.
